What is a data analyst coach?

A Data Analyst Coach is a professional who helps individuals or teams develop and improve their data analysis skills. They provide guidance on data analytics tools, techniques, and best practices, often through personalized mentoring, workshops, and feedback on real-world projects. Data Analyst Coaches work with clients to identify skill gaps, set learning goals, and support their growth in areas such as data visualization, statistical analysis, and problem-solving. Their goal is to empower others to make data-driven decisions and succeed in data-focused roles.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a data analyst coach?

To thrive as a Data Analyst Coach, you need a solid background in data analysis, statistics, and teaching or mentoring, often supported by a degree in a quantitative field and relevant industry experience. Familiarity with analytics tools like Excel, SQL, Python, and visualization platforms such as Tableau or Power BI, as well as instructional certifications, is typically expected. Outstanding communication, patience, and the ability to give constructive feedback are crucial soft skills for effectively guiding learners. These skills ensure you can translate complex data concepts into accessible lessons, fostering both technical growth and confidence in your mentees.

What are some common challenges data analyst coaches face when supporting new analysts, and how can they overcome them?

Data Analyst Coaches often encounter challenges such as varying skill levels among trainees, helping individuals adapt to rapidly changing analytical tools, and bridging the gap between theoretical concepts and real-world application. To overcome these, coaches should tailor their guidance to individual learning needs, stay updated on industry trends, and create practical, hands-on learning opportunities. Encouraging open communication and fostering a collaborative environment also helps new analysts feel supported and confident as they build their skills.

What is the difference between Data Analyst Coach vs Data Analyst?

AspectData Analyst CoachData Analyst
CredentialsOften requires experience in data analysis and coaching certificationsTypically requires a degree in data science, statistics, or related field
Work EnvironmentFocuses on training, mentoring, and developing data analystsPerforms data analysis, reporting, and data management tasks
Employer & IndustryUsed in organizations with training programs or analytics teamsFound across industries performing data-driven roles
Search & Comparison IntentOften searched by those seeking coaching or mentorship rolesCommonly searched by individuals looking for data analysis roles

The main difference is that a Data Analyst Coach focuses on mentoring and training data analysts, while a Data Analyst performs hands-on data analysis tasks. The coach role emphasizes skill development and team support, whereas the analyst role centers on analyzing data to inform business decisions.

Job description

100% Remote Full-time Senior Analyst
At NuView Analytics - we help companies accelerate the time to insights from their data. We do this in three ways - data analytics, data diligence, and fractional data science. Our clients are growth stage companies looking to drive additional value from the data they are sitting on. Through our values of - humility, intellectual rigor, and stewardship - we help companies gain a new perspective on their business through their data.
Salary: $90k-120K + bonus + benefits
Location: 100% remote for US-based candidates
Responsibilities:
  • Candidate will complete data analytics and data science projects for clients
  • Candidate will be a key leader in researching and helping the company learn about new technologies/skillsets that are not currently possessed by the firm
  • Candidate will take Lead on client projects from start to finish - scoping, onboarding, delivering
  • Candidate will train and develop new team members in both engagement process and data analytics skill sets when needed

Projects Include:
  • Ad-hoc data analysis
  • Deep data investigation
  • Data visualization
  • Data integration
  • ETL Development
  • Statistical modeling and machine learning

Qualifications:
  • Bachelors Degree in Analytics, Economics, Mathematics, Computer Science or a related Field
  • 3-5 Years of Relevant job experience
  • SQL Required
  • R or Python experience a plus
  • Tableau, Power BI, or Looker all stars
  • Looking for a self-starter that can work well autonomously and together with a team to figure out solutions for clients
  • Ability to Lead other team members as a player coach, completing projects side-by-side and teaching junior team members best practices and techniques
  • Ability to process data objectively and efficiently
  • Intellectually curious about new data tools and data analytics/science strategies
  • Familiarity across modern data stack including ETL (Stitch, Rivery, Fivetran, etc), Data warehouse (Big Query, Redshift, Snowflake, etc.) and Data Visualization (Tableau, Looker, Power BI, etc.)
